Output 65f90fe0dc33a804b536d889fdd0cd1a5bd95dc764db31bbb3ede6ff640ea0f4:5

value
11360000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b91a843f1dfec7d2aa7946e4aaaafbfbc2d245a4 OP_EQUAL
address
3JZkhSK4qFMKjuFmuDQzJECGbEBX8t7GgK
transaction
65f90fe0dc33a804b536d889fdd0cd1a5bd95dc764db31bbb3ede6ff640ea0f4
confirmations
460308
spent
true